PDA

View Full Version : سوال: خطا در چاپ کریستال ریپورت



Ali0Boy
پنج شنبه 25 اسفند 1390, 09:42 صبح
باسلام و خسته نباشید
من یک پروژه نوشتم، قسمتی از اون قراره که یک کریستال ریپورت رو چاپ کند.
در پروژه های قبلی هیچ مشکلی نداشت اما حالا با خطایی که در تصویر مشاهده می کنید روبرو شدم.
این پروژه در سیستم خودم به درستی جواب می دهد ولی وقتی در سیستم مشتری اجرا می کنم با خطا مواجه می شود.
با بررسی که کردم خودم فهمیدم که خطا به server name می دهد که آدرس آن ایستا است. حال می خواستم بدونم چطور می توانم این آدرس داینامیک کنم و مثلا آدرس:
Application.StartupPath+@"\data\bank.mdb" رو بعنوان آدرس server name قرار بدهم. ممنون می شوم راهنمایی کنید و یا اگر پستی در این ضمینه هست من رو به اونجا راهنمایی کنید چون هر چه گشتم پستی با چنین عنوان و یا مربوط به server name پیدا نکردم.

Ali0Boy
جمعه 26 اسفند 1390, 08:39 صبح
دوستان و اساتید کسی نیست منو راهنمایی کنه. شدیدا عجله دارم.

barnamenevisforme
جمعه 26 اسفند 1390, 09:34 صبح
سلام
از توی منوی بخش settings project/project name properties نوع connection string رو به string تغییر بده البته سطح دسترسی رو هم user تعریف کن.بعد یه dialog واسه کاربر قرار بده که در صورت عدم ارتباط با server بتونه نام server رو تغییر بده .بعد شما connection string جدید رو با نام server جدید بساز و توی setting ذخیره کن. 84259